ajax的删除数据库数据库数据(ajax删除数据的思路)
在编程开发中,经常会涉及到对数据库的操作,其中删除数据是一个常见的需求。介绍如何使用Ajax来删除数据库中的数据,以及相关的解决方案和代码示例。
问题背景
在开发过程中,我们经常需要删除数据库中的数据。传统的做法是通过后端语言(如PHP、Java等)来处理删除操作,并刷新页面展示删除后的数据。这种方式会导致页面的刷新,用户体验较差。为了提升用户体验,我们可以使用Ajax来实现删除操作,无需刷新页面即可完成删除。
解决方案
使用Ajax删除数据库数据的思路如下:
1. 前端页面中,通过点击删除按钮触发Ajax请求。
2. Ajax请求后端接口,将要删除的数据的标识(如ID)作为参数传递给后端。
3. 后端接收到Ajax请求后,根据传递的参数执行删除操作。
4. 后端删除数据后,返回响应给前端,告知删除操作是否成功。
5. 前端根据后端返回的响应,更新页面展示。
代码示例
下面是一个使用jQuery库实现Ajax删除数据库数据的代码示例:
“`javascript
// 前端页面
$(document).on(‘click’, ‘.delete-button’, function() {
var id = $(this).data(‘id’); // 获取要删除数据的ID
$.ajax({
url: ‘delete.php’, // 后端接口地址
type: ‘POST’,
data: {id: id}, // 将ID作为参数传递给后端
success: function(response) {
if (response.success) {
// 删除成功,更新页面展示
// …
} else {
// 删除失败,处理错误信息
// …
}
},
error: function() {
// 处理请求错误
// …
}
});
});
// 后端接口(delete.php)
$id = $_POST[‘id’]; // 获取前端传递的ID参数
// 执行删除操作
// …
$response = array(‘success’ => true); // 删除成功
// $response = array(‘success’ => false, ‘message’ => ‘删除失败’); // 删除失败
echo json_encode($response); // 返回响应给前端
“`
通过使用Ajax来删除数据库数据,我们可以提升用户体验,无需刷新页面即可完成删除操作。使用Ajax删除数据库数据的思路,并给出了相关的解决方案和代码示例。希望能对编程开发者在实际开发中有所帮助。
文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/85064.html<